The U.S. Coast Guard is seeking to procure specialized marine equipment to support operational dive teams and raiding craft missions. - Government Buyer: - U.S. Coast Guard, Department of Homeland Security - LOG-94 Regional Contracting West, Alameda, CA - PAC-3DSF Dive Force - OEMs and Vendors: - Raider Outboard Motors (Raider) - Zodiac Nautic (Zodiac) - Products/Services Requested: - 6 x 65 HP Raider Outboard Motors, 2-Stroke, 3-Cylinder, Multi-Fuel, Submersible (Part Number: R50-ES-002) - 6 x Raider Model 50 Motor Support Kits (Part Number: R508803) - 6 x Raider Model 50 Ready Service/Spare Parts Kits (Part Number: R50-2500R50) - 6 x Zodiac MK5/FC580 HD Floor/Stringer Kits (Part Number: ZE23907) - 6 x Zodiac FC580 Rigid Floor Black, Long-Shaft, FC Hull, I/C Valves, Removable Speed Tubes (Part Number: Z80492) - 6 x Zodiac Fuel Bladder Marine 9 USG (Part Number: Z66109) - 6 x Zodiac Dripless Fuel Line, 15' Raider OBM (Part Number: N45451) - Shipping for all equipment to three regional dive lockers (Portsmouth, VA; National City, CA; Honolulu, HI) - Unique/Notable Requirements: - Outboard motors must comply with duty-free entry and domestic re-manufacturing requirements - Delivery timelines: motors and kits within 90 days; boats and accessories within 270 days after contract award - Coordination with technical points of contact for delivery - All equipment must be suitable for multi-fuel, submersible, and de-watering operations - Compliance with FAR and HSAR clauses

Description

The objective of this contract is to procure six (6) Combat Rubber Raiding Craft (CRRC) boats, six (6) multi-fuel outboard motors, and all ancillary equipment as specified in this Statement of Work. The supplies are required to support U.S. Coast Guard operational needs.
